Motel Mexicola

Location: https://maps.app.goo.gl/4d7ECJ36ACVt1ZGN9

Night party at Motel Mexicola
Image source: Motel Mexicola Instagram

Whenever I’m in the mood for a high-energy fiesta, I head straight to Motel Mexicola. This place is a colorful explosion of 1960s Acapulco vibes—bright murals, neon lights, and, of course, endless margaritas.

Their tacos and burritos are as vibrant as the décor, and let’s not forget their Guinness World Record for margarita sales. Dancing on tables is basically a requirement here, and I’m all in for the lively, anything-goes atmosphere.

Da Maria

Location: https://maps.app.goo.gl/KdYcPiPoQPzsZZQk9

Da Maria 's interior
Image source: Da Maria website

Da Maria is my go-to for a night that starts with Italian indulgence and ends on the dance floor. The homemade pastas and hand-tossed pizzas are perfect for fueling up, and their Island Spritz is the ideal pre-game companion.

By the time the DJs take over on Wednesdays and Sundays, I’m ready to join the crowd and dance the night away in this chic Seminyak hotspot.

Ryoshi House of Jazz

Location: https://maps.app.goo.gl/csVoVFTKjhSHYVbs6

Image source: Ryoshi House of Jazz Google Profile

Ryoshi is where I go for a unique blend of Japanese cuisine and soulful jazz.

As one of the first Japanese spots in Seminyak, their menu is both extensive and reasonably priced. But it’s the jazz nights on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ays that truly set this place apart.

The intimate setting, paired with live performances, makes for a relaxed yet captivating night out.

Atlas Super Club

Location: https://maps.app.goo.gl/MAi5cVqCKSNFnpeB9

Image source: Atlas Super Club Instagram

Atlas Super Club is the crown jewel of Bali’s nightlife scene.

This colossal, three-story nightclub is an experience in itself, boasting state-of-the-art sound and lighting that amplify every beat. I’ve danced the night away here to world-class DJs like Timmy Trumpet and Steve Aoki, feeling the bass reverberate through the crowd.

Whether you’re on the main floor or exploring the upper levels, Atlas delivers a party like no other.

Laughing Buddha Bar

Location: https://maps.app.goo.gl/gj5gL78jx3UW2cAq7

Image source: Laughing Buddha website

When I want a night filled with soulful live music and good vibes, I head to Laughing Buddha Bar.

Just a short stroll from Ubud’s Monkey Forest, this spot pulses with energy, featuring everything from jazz and blues-rock to world music and even salsa nights.

I always make it in time for their happy hour, grabbing two-for-one mojitos before the bands hit the stage. It’s the kind of place where the music draws you in, and the crowd makes you stay.

Tips for Enjoying Bali’s Nightlife Safely

Bali’s nightlife is a thrilling mix of beats, drinks, and unforgettable vibes. But let’s keep it real—staying safe means the fun never stops. 

First rule? 

Starting with a hard no to driving under the influence. Seriously, just forget the keys. 

The island’s roads can be tricky, especially at night. Thankfully, getting around is easy: taxis, rideshares, and private drivers are readily available outside most venues. 

Don’t risk it—it’s not worth your life or someone else’s.

Hydration is your best friend, especially in Bali’s balmy climate. Balance those cocktails with plenty of water to keep your energy up and your morning hangover-free. 

While the island’s nightlife is famously friendly, it’s always smart to stay aware of your surroundings. Keep your belongings close and watch your drink—just good practice anywhere.

Dress the part, but keep it chill. Bali’s style is casual yet classy, so a polished look goes a long way without overdoing it. 

And remember, a little respect for the space and others keeps the good vibes flowing—no wild antics that might land you on someone’s story for the wrong reasons.

One more tip: Check your villa’s rules on guests. Not all accommodations welcome after-party invites, and it’s best to know before the night begins.
